    PCG Vancouver attends the commemoration of the 96th Death Anniversary of Benjamin “Benson” Flores

    15 APRIL 2025, VANCOUVER, BC. The Philippine Consulate General attended the commemorative ceremony of the 96th Death Anniversary of Benjamin “Benson” Flores, the first Filipino on record to have immigrated to Canada, on 11 April 2025 at the Mountain View Cemetery in Vancouver, BC.
